Baseline: Browse Traffic Before the Thumbnail Update

Before the redesign, Browse traffic came from Home, Subscriptions, and other recommendation surfaces. The channel was getting impressions, but the thumbnails weren’t pulling enough clicks. That’s the starting point for the baseline.

Starting Metrics from YouTube Analytics

YouTube Analytics

In the 28 days before the thumbnail update, the case study tracked baseline metrics in YouTube Analytics: Browse impressions, Browse CTR, views from Browse, and Browse share of total views. The right way to read those numbers is against the channel’s own averages, not in isolation.

Why the Old Thumbnails Underperformed in Browse

The pre-update thumbnails had several issues that often drag down Browse performance: low contrast, too much visual clutter, a weak focal point, and text that was too small or too dense to read on mobile. On a thumbnail that may appear at about 168×94 pixels, those choices made the images harder to scan in a busy feed. So the videos earned impressions but lost clicks.

That matters more in Browse than many creators think. On Home and other recommendation surfaces, people make a click choice in a split second. If the package doesn’t read fast, it gets passed over. This is a core principle of thumbnail psychology and viewer behavior.

This baseline is a starting point, not proof that thumbnails alone caused the weak performance. Topic demand, upload timing, and recommendation patterns can also shape Browse distribution. The next step was to change the thumbnail package and see whether Browse performance moved.

Thumbnail Changes Made and How They Were Executed

Design Updates That Made the Thumbnails Easier to Click

The redesign was a focused cleanup. Each thumbnail was stripped down to 2–3 core elements: the face, one key object, and a short text phrase.

Small logos, extra shapes, and busy background details were removed or blurred. The main subject sat on one side of the frame, with bold text on the other. The face was cropped much tighter, taking up 50–70% of the thumbnail width, so the expression could still read on a phone screen.

Expressions were picked to match the video's emotional hook and pushed a bit so they came through at small sizes. Backgrounds moved to solid colors, light gradients, or heavily blurred imagery, which pulled attention toward the subject and text. Text was cut to 2–4 bold words that named the outcome directly. Fonts got larger and heavier, with a solid color block or drop shadow behind the text to keep it readable.

The end result was a thumbnail built for fast scanning in Browse. After that, the team tested those layout shifts across new thumbnail variants.

Here’s how the main design elements changed from the original thumbnails to the redesigned versions:

Element Before After
Contrast Low; similar tones between background, text, and subject High; bright subject and text against a darker or simplified background
Face visibility Small, competing with other elements; expressions unreadable on mobile Large, close-cropped; clear expressions visible at small sizes
Text clarity Long, sentence-like text in thin fonts Short, bold, outcome-focused phrases (2–4 words); large, high-contrast fonts
Focal point Multiple competing elements; no clear visual priority Single dominant focal point (face or key object) with strong visual hierarchy
Alignment with video hook Generic imagery that didn't show the result or transformation Outcome-driven imagery (graphs, before/after, arrows) tied directly to the video's promise
Background complexity Busy backgrounds with many details Simplified or blurred; directs attention to subject and text
Consistency across thumbnails Inconsistent styles, fonts, and layouts Standardized layout, color palette, and typography across the channel
Creation workflow Manual design; few variants per video AI-assisted with templates, face/object swapping; multiple variants tested quickly

Testing showed a clear pattern: large faces, upward-trending visuals, and short outcome text led to stronger early CTR on Browse. The next section shows how those variants changed Browse impressions, CTR, and views.

Results: Changes in Browse Impressions, CTR, and Views

YouTube Browse Traffic: Before vs. After Thumbnail Redesign

YouTube Browse Traffic: Before vs. After Thumbnail Redesign

Before-and-After Metrics Over the Tracking Window

Once the new thumbnails went live, the next two 28-day windows gave a clear read on how Browse responded. Browse traffic came from YouTube Analytics across two matching periods: July 1–July 28, 2026 (before the thumbnail update) and July 29–August 25, 2026 (after).

After the move to simpler layouts, stronger contrast, and larger faces, every Browse metric moved up fast:

Metric Before (Jul 1–28) After (Jul 29–Aug 25)
Browse impressions 80,000 145,000
Browse CTR 3.4% 6.1%
Browse views 2,700 8,800
Browse as % of total views 22% 41%

The signal here is hard to miss. Impressions went up, and CTR climbed at the same time. Browse views jumped by 226%, pushed by both more impressions and more clicks. Browse also went from 22% of total channel views to 41%, which is close to doubling its share of traffic.

What the Performance Shift Suggests About Browse Distribution

The numbers point to a simple idea: a higher Browse CTR may have helped YouTube test these videos with more people on Home and other Browse surfaces. Browse impressions rose from 80,000 to 145,000, an 81% increase, during the same window that CTR climbed from 3.4% to 6.1%. Put plainly, the videos appeared in Browse more often after viewers started clicking more often.

That said, this is an interpretation, not proof of cause and effect. YouTube has not published an exact formula showing how CTR affects distribution. Still, the timing matters. Impressions climbed right after the thumbnail change, and there were no major shifts in titles or topics. That makes thumbnails the most likely reason for the lift. The bigger point is simple: a stronger thumbnail may do more than lift CTR on its own. It may also change how hard YouTube pushes the video on Home.

Methodology and Limits of This Case Study

The setup was pretty simple: lock in a baseline, implement a thumbnail update strategy as the main variable, keep other factors as steady as possible, and track the results in standard YouTube Analytics reports. Upload pace stayed at two videos per week in both windows. Browse data came from the Traffic Source breakdown so the analysis stayed focused on Browse performance.

This was not a perfectly controlled test. It wasn't a lab setup, and other factors can affect Browse impressions, including seasonality, platform shifts, audience growth, and topic strength. Those limits matter when looking at the results.

Conclusion: Key Lessons for Browse-Focused Thumbnails

This case showed a pretty clear pattern: clearer thumbnails led to better Browse performance. When the thumbnail had stronger contrast, one clear focal point, and an obvious payoff, Browse clicks went up. That tracks with how Browse works. People make a split-second call, so the thumbnail has to make the value clear at a glance.

Here are four practical takeaways:

  • Isolate thumbnail changes whenever possible. The redesign worked because the creator kept uploads and topics steady, so the thumbnail was the clearest variable. Change one major variable, then measure.
  • Track Browse impressions, CTR, and Browse views over 30 to 60 days. Judge the result after enough impressions, not after just a few days.
  • Refresh evergreen videos with proven demand and weak CTR. A better thumbnail on an existing video can open the door to more Browse exposure.

FAQs

Why did simpler thumbnails improve Browse performance?

Simpler thumbnails tend to do better in Browse because they stop the scroll faster. People there usually move quickly through their feed. They’re not hunting for one specific video, so your thumbnail needs one clear focal point right away.

Busy designs often get skipped or become tough to read, especially on mobile. High-contrast colors, expressive faces, and 3 to 5 words create a cleaner visual order and help viewers understand the video’s value at a glance.

How long should I test a thumbnail change?

Test a thumbnail change for at least 7 to 14 days so you get data from both weekdays and weekends. That gives you a better read on how people respond across different viewing habits.

Don’t judge the result in the first 48 hours. Early numbers can be noisy and may not show how the thumbnail will perform over time.

It also helps if each version gets around 1,000 to 5,000 impressions. And once you change a thumbnail, wait at least 30 days before changing it again.
